1. Understanding Our Roots: A Journey into the Past

Ancient history is the foundation upon which the pillars of modern society stand. By exploring the civilizations of old, we gain invaluable insights into the origins of our culture, beliefs, and traditions. From the towering pyramids of Egypt to the intricate philosophies of ancient Greece, we discover the roots of our shared humanity and the diverse paths that have led us to where we are today.

1.1 Cultural Identity and Heritage: Embracing Our Ancestry

Ancient history is the story of our ancestors, their struggles, triumphs, and legacies. It shapes our cultural identity, providing a sense of belonging and connection to a broader narrative that transcends time. Through the study of ancient civilizations, we appreciate the uniqueness and richness of our heritage, fostering a sense of pride and purpose.

3. Innovation and Adaptation: Lessons from Ancient Ingenuity

Ancient civilizations faced unique challenges and limitations, yet they demonstrated remarkable ingenuity in overcoming them. Their innovations, from engineering marvels to medical advancements, continue to inspire us today. By studying ancient technologies and techniques, we can gain fresh perspectives and find creative solutions to modern problems.

3.1 Sustainable Solutions: Learning from Ancient Wisdom

Ancient civilizations often lived in harmony with their environment, employing sustainable practices that ensured the longevity of their societies. From water management systems to agricultural techniques, we can learn from their wisdom and apply it to address contemporary environmental challenges.
